How Much Do Restaurant Celebration Spaces in Darjeeling Cost?

Pricing for restaurant celebration spaces in Darjeeling varies by guest count, menu complexity, and whether décor is bundled. On average, celebration restaurant bookings for a simple birthday or anniversary dinner with a set menu start at INR 800–1,200 per head for a vegetarian spread. Non-vegetarian multi-course menus with Tibetan, Bengali, and Continental options typically fall between INR 1,400–2,200 per head. Premium rooftop or heritage-property setups with Kanchenjunga views, floral décor, a dedicated event coordinator, and custom cake arrangements can reach INR 2,800–3,500 per head. Minimum guaranteed covers (MGC) are standard — most venues require a minimum booking of 20 covers for private dining venues in Darjeeling, while smaller semi-private sections may allow 10–15 covers. Hiring indoor party venues for a full buyout (exclusive access) starts from INR 35,000 and can go up to INR 1.5 lakh depending on the property tier. Always confirm whether GST at 18% is included in quoted rates and whether corkage, sound system, and parking are charged separately.

Types of Restaurant Celebration Spaces Available in Darjeeling

Understanding the variety helps you match your event's mood to the right setup. Private dining venues in Darjeeling generally fall into five categories. First, standalone private rooms inside mid-range restaurants seat 10–30 guests with a dedicated waiter and customisable menu. Second, rooftop terrace venues offer open-air celebration restaurant bookings under fairy lights with views of the valley — ideal for evening events during spring and autumn. Third, heritage bungalow dining halls converted into special occasion dining spaces seat up to 80 guests and carry colonial-era character with wooden flooring and period furniture. Fourth, hotel restaurant annexes attached to boutique stays provide the convenience of on-site accommodation for outstation family members. Fifth, café buyouts in artisan cafés near Chowrasta work brilliantly for youth-centric celebrations like milestone birthdays or bridal showers with 15–25 guests. Each format comes with different service standards, décor flexibility, and noise restrictions, so shortlisting based on your event type first will save considerable back-and-forth.

Why Should You Choose Indoor Party Venues Over Open Banquet Halls?

Darjeeling's weather is famously unpredictable — fog, drizzle, or sudden cold can descend without warning even in peak season. Indoor party venues eliminate weather risk entirely while still delivering a mountain view experience through large glass windows and skylights. Sound management is also easier indoors; restaurants with acoustic panelling ensure speeches and music stay crisp without disturbing neighbouring properties, which matters in the tightly packed hill-town layout. From a catering standpoint, closed kitchens in established restaurants maintain consistent food temperature — a non-trivial challenge at 2,100 metres altitude where cold wind can lower plated food temperatures within minutes. Indoor spaces also allow better control over lighting design, which directly shapes photography and video output. Finally, Darjeeling hospitality venues with indoor setups typically have experienced event staff who understand hill-town guest logistics like parking constraints, narrow approach lanes, and local vendor coordination — expertise that saves you hours of planning.

How Do You Choose the Right Special Occasion Dining Space in Darjeeling?

Choosing the right special occasion dining spaces requires matching four variables: guest count, budget per head, desired ambience, and service scope. Begin by locking your guest list within a 20% range — most venues penalise over-bookings and under-attendance equally through their MGC clauses. Next, assess whether your event needs a curated festive dining experience with themed décor and entertainment, or a simpler, food-forward celebration. Visit shortlisted venues in person or via a verified Happiffie listing to check parking availability, restroom hygiene, generator backup, and kitchen hygiene ratings. Ask for a tasting session if you are booking for 40 or more guests — reputable celebration restaurant bookings always accommodate this. Confirm that the venue holds a valid FSSAI licence and, for alcohol service, the relevant Sikkim/West Bengal excise permit. Finally, request a written event order document detailing timelines, menu, décor inclusions, and penalty clauses — verbal commitments are insufficient for mountain venues where third-party vendor delays are common.

People Also Ask

What is the average capacity of restaurant celebration spaces in Darjeeling?
Most restaurant celebration spaces in Darjeeling accommodate between 10 and 120 guests. Intimate private rooms seat 10–30 people, mid-size heritage halls handle 40–80 guests, and full-venue buyouts at larger properties can host up to 120. Always confirm the seating layout — banquet style differs significantly from round-table or cocktail arrangements in the same square footage.
Which neighbourhoods in Darjeeling have the best celebration restaurant options?
Chowrasta and Mall Road offer the highest concentration of quality celebration restaurant bookings with easy pedestrian access. Lebong and Jalapahar provide quieter, more scenic setups for intimate events. Ghoom suits early-morning or daytime events with monastery backdrop views. Darjeeling's compact layout means most areas are reachable within 20 minutes from the main town.

Are outdoor restaurant celebration spaces available in Darjeeling?
Yes, rooftop terraces and garden-adjacent setups function as outdoor restaurant celebration spaces in Darjeeling, particularly during the spring and autumn seasons. However, Darjeeling's unpredictable fog and rain make indoor party venues generally safer for large gatherings. Most outdoor venues have retractable weather covers or can shift the event inside at short notice.
How far in advance should I book private dining venues in Darjeeling for a wedding anniversary?
For private dining venues in Darjeeling, booking 4–6 weeks in advance is recommended for weekday events. Weekend slots and peak tourist season dates — March to May and September to November — fill up 8–12 weeks ahead. Heritage properties with limited seating can be booked out even earlier, so early enquiry via platforms like Happiffie is strongly advised.
Do Darjeeling restaurant celebration spaces provide decoration services?
Most mid-range and premium restaurant celebration spaces in Darjeeling offer in-house basic décor — balloon setups, table centrepieces, and a small floral arrangement. For elaborate themes or custom installations, venues typically allow external decorators subject to a setup fee. Confirm décor inclusions, setup timing, and any restrictions on open flames or confetti before finalising.
Is alcohol service available at celebration restaurant bookings in Darjeeling?
Darjeeling falls under West Bengal excise regulations. Many established hotels and restaurants hold valid liquor licences and can serve alcohol at celebration restaurant bookings. Some smaller venues are dry and allow BYOB with a corkage fee. Always verify the venue's liquor licence status before planning a celebration where alcohol service is expected.

What is the best time of year to book restaurant celebration spaces in Darjeeling?
March to May and September to November offer the best weather for restaurant celebration spaces in Darjeeling — clear skies, mild temperatures, and the highest chance of Kanchenjunga visibility. The monsoon months of June to August bring heavy rain and fog, making indoor party venues the safest choice. December and January are cold but festive and increasingly popular for New Year celebrations.
Is parking available near celebration restaurant bookings in Darjeeling?
Parking in Darjeeling's town centre is limited due to narrow hill-road layouts. Most celebration restaurant bookings at hotels or heritage properties include a small dedicated parking area, typically accommodating 10–20 vehicles. For larger groups, venues coordinate with nearby municipal parking lots or recommend shared taxis. Confirm parking capacity when you book.
